摘要

随着可再生能源技术飞速发展,高比例分布式电源的接入给配电网的规划运行带来了新的挑战,而储能系统运行优化的合理配置对于提升配电网运行安全性与经济性有着重要作用。鉴于配电网追求的安全稳定运行目标与储能系统追求的经济性目标之间存在对立关系,为此提出一种基于主从博弈推演的配电网分布式储能配置-运行优化方法。该方法通过构建配电网运营商作为领导者、分布式储能运营商作为跟随者的主从博弈框架,并引入多目标粒子群算法结合内点法的混合求解策略,求出博弈双方策略互动下的最优均衡解。通过算例分析表明,该方法可有效模拟配电网与储能运营商之间的策略博弈过程,还能显著提升配电网电压运行安全,同时实现了储能系统运行成本的有效控制。

Abstract

With the rapid development of renewable energy technologies, the integration of high-penetration distributed generation poses new challenges to the planning and operation of distribution networks. Meanwhile, the rational allocation and optimized operation of distributed energy storage (DES) are of great significance in enhancing the safe and economy of distribution networks. Since the contradictory relationship between the safe and stable operation goals for the distributed network and the economic goals for DES, the thesis focus on a new method of configuration-operation optimization on for distributed DES based on Stackelberg game theory. This method contracts a framework with distributed network as a leader and DES operators as followers. Also, a mixed solution strategy of multi-objective particle swarm optimization algorithm combined with interior point method to obtain the optimal equilibrium solution is introduced in the paper. Case study shows that the proposed approach can effectively simulate the strategic game process between the distribution network and energy storage operators, significantly improve the voltage operation safety of the distribution network, and achieve effective control of DES′s operation cost.
